The Bonaventure Cemetery was established in 1846 as a private cemetery on the site of the old Bonaventure Plantation, birthplace of future Georgia governor Josiah Tatnall.

In 1907, the Bonaventure Cemetary became a public cemetary. Savannah now owns & operates 5 cemeteries , and Bonaventure is the largest of those. Learn more from this C-SPAN American History TV video. Read more

Made famous by the novel and movie , Midnight in the Garden of Good and Evil , Bonaventure is a public cemetery overlooking the Wilmington River . It is the largest Savannah cemetery , spanning 160 acres. Read more
